- To use BibFrame and OLframe the keyboard macro file "bibframe.kbm3"
- can be used. Unfortunately it is the case that the macros ESC-bk and
- ESC-bm do not work together with OLframe and it seems to be impossible
- to make them work as before. One solution to this problem is to use
- two keyboard macros to input the "key":
-
- <\!bk1 : \!sv\x489 \x9 \ \x489 \x9 []\x489 cite- >
- <\!bk2 : \x489 \x9 \x9 \x9 \x9 \ \xd \xd >
-
- ESC-bk1 is used to pop up the variable creation window and making []
- the value of the variable and "cite-" the beginning of the variable
- name. The "key" should be appended to "cite-" and the value of the
- variable can be modified. Then use ESC-bk2 to insert the variable in
- the document.
